Do you know the history of this engine?
What are the chances it has seats installed for the valves? Could it be a head gasket, sure, but it could be a lot of other things. If you haven't removed the head yet, I would pressurize the water system lightly and check in the port. (20-30 psi max) Have had port rust thru just below the valve seat area, valve seat crack below the seat, crack thru seat into cylinder, you get the point. Best of luck, John
